I recently discovered a very nice clock program. The program is called ClocX and can be obtained at http://clocx.php5.cz/. It is highly configurable in terms of settings, shape, size, and background images. It has several nice options, including my personal favorite "click through", which allows it to be set to stay on top of other windows but lets you interact with the window beneath it as if the clock was not there. This is the nicest donationware clock program I have ever found and is better than many shareware clock programs.  :Thmbsup: If you need alarms, however, you'll need to look elsewhere.

Hi all.

I generally appreciate the information the OS gives me in bubble messages. The big exception, however, is when my wifi link connects, disconnects, connects, disconnects, etc. The message is something like "Wireless Internet Connection is now connected." I see this message about 15 times/day and I'm sick of it. Each time, it 'patiently waits' for me to close it, not only annoying me, but demanding attention as well.

I would love a program that could close this message, maybe a few (specifyable) seconds after it opens. That way I know I am losing and re-establishing my connection, but I don't have to close the window myself. It might also be nice though if I could sometimes eliminate this window completely, perhaps by making it invisible or closing it before it could be drawn on the screen.

Ideally, this program would be an ahk script so I could learn from the code, though I know that beggers can't be choosers. However, I would be THRILLED to have a program written in ANY language that would do this.
